The data indicates that the most common mileage recorded for the Saab 9-3 (2002-07) saloon is between 110,000 and 120,000 miles, accounting for 13.1% of vehicles. Notably, a significant proportion of vehicles have higher mileage, with 12% recorded between 80,000 and 90,000 miles, and another 10.6% between 90,000 and 100,000 miles. Lower mileage readings are relatively rare, with only 0.4% each registered at mileage bands of 0-10,000 miles and 10,000-20,000 miles. There is a visible distribution peak around the 100,000 to 120,000 mile range, suggesting these cars often reach this mileage before significant use or resale. Additionally, the data shows small percentages of vehicles with very high mileages exceeding 200,000 miles, indicating some vehicles do sustain extensive use over time.

The data indicates that the majority of private sale valuations for the Saab 9-3 (2002-07) 4DR Saloon 1.8T 150 Vector are concentrated in the under £1,000 range, accounting for approximately 98.2% of sales. Only a small fraction, about 1.8%, are priced between £1,000 and £2,000. This suggests that most private sellers expect the vehicle to have a relatively low market value, which may reflect its age, condition, or market demand for this specific model.

The data indicates that the most common main paint colours for the Saab 9-3 (2002-07) 4-door saloon 1.8T 150 Vector are Black (26.1%) and Silver (24.4%), suggesting these classic hues are particularly popular among owners. Blue also features prominently at 22.6%. In contrast, colours like white (0.4%) and green (0.7%) are quite rare, reflecting perhaps less preference or availability. Overall, darker and neutral tones dominate the palette, with strikingly few vehicles in brighter colours like yellow or white.
